EFFECT OF BACTERIA ON PARTIAL REPLACEMENT OF CONCRETE WITH FLY-ASH AND GGBS
Ravindranatha, N. Kannan, Likhit M. L
Abstract: The responsibility of the construction industry is not only to provide quality construction but also to provide a clean environment. With the rapid industrialization and urbanization, the generation of industrial by-product is also increasing very rapidly. This is not only pollutes the environment but also creates disposal problems. This paper gives information about the research carried out on cement with a partial replacement with fly ash and GGBS with bacteria in the mix giving great results and being highly sustainable and eco-friendly. From the results of the investigation, it has been observed that, the performance of blended cement concrete is better than that of the conventional concrete
Keywords: Bacillus pasteurii, compressive strength, flexural strength, and Bio-calcification.
